In order to achieve our goals, ThinQ engages in the following activities:
Creating learning and teaching resources aimed at facilitating Inquiry-Oriented Learning, including audio, video, and text material, with exposition, activities, worksheets, and learning triggers that help develop inquiry abilities.
Creating assessment tasks that test inquiry and critical thinking abilities.
Developing a network of resource persons who can empower teachers through workshops and online interactions.
Providing curriculum support to schools and school systems, to create learning environments in harmony with inquiry and critical thinking abilities.
Partnering with like-minded individuals and groups to work towards a better world through education.
